    We have a license to Events Calendar Pro; we are considering using Event Tickets to allow prospective attendees to register for no-cost workshops. I noticed this caveat on the Event Tickets page: “Please note that at this time, Event Tickets will NOT support RSVP for recurring events. Please keep this in mind before making your purchase.”

    Does this mean that 1) people cannot RSVP for multiple events at the same time with a single registration, or does this mean that 2) people cannot register for an event using the Event Tickets plugin if the event itself is a recurring event? It is not clear from the way it is worded above. If it is #2, we cannot use the plugin because many of our events are recurring. Please advise.

    Does this mean that 1) people cannot RSVP for multiple events at the same time with a single registration, or does this mean that 2) people cannot register for an event using the Event Tickets plugin if the event itself is a recurring event?

    What that means is that the RSVP (or paid) tickets assigned to a recurring event act for the whole series.

    In other words, each event of the recurring series does not get its own RSVP or ticket. It’s all one giant pool of ticket that applies to the whole series.

    Please note that now that we have just rebuild our ticketing engine, we will work at making this a reality. Unfortunately, I cannot commit to a release date at this point. But stay tuned!

    Another solution is to break the recurring event series into single events (not a great workaround, but that will work).
